The Printing House
421 Hudson St, Manhattan, NY 10014

The Printing House is a midrise condo building located at 421 Hudson St in Manhattan's West Village. It was built in 1920 (Pre-war). The structure rises 10 stories, has a total building area of 255,575 Sq. Ft. and contains 155 units.

West Village
A beloved pocket of lower Manhattan. The West Village is a destination for shopping, nightlife, and daytime strolls along winding streets. With colonial brownstones, towering trees, and stylish residents, the West Village can sometimes feel like a real-life New York City movie set.
